The New York Giants have a had a tumultuous past five years. While the Giants are one of the most successful NFL franchises of all time with 4 Super Bowl wins under their belt, the past five years has been a dismal time to be a Giants fan.

So what is next for Joe Judge, the head coach of the Giants? For starters, he is going to have to find a new offensive coordinator/assistant coach. As we all know based off of the headline, the Giants fired offensive coordinator Jason Garrett back on November 23rd after a poor offensive start to the season. At that point, the Giants record was a weak 3-7.

Judge is going to have to spend a fair amount of time seeking the right candidate to replace Garrett. Many fans and analysts feel that Judge himself should be more to blame for the past two years of pain.
